Lets check some of the best ones:
1) Bushnell’s AR Optics Line: This line is designed with black rifles in mind, from the ground up. The 1-4x24mm model offers flexibility for many distances, from a few feet to a few hundred yards. It is an ideal scope for an AR-15, and costs a little bit more for the quality.
2) Leupold’s Mark AR MOD 13-9x40mm: This scope is a really useful power range, ideal for shots that aren’t at an extremely close range. It adds more magnification for shots that need a little more at the top end. Perfect for hunting deer or punching paper and steel at medium ranges. It is a little more costly, but the quality is worth every dollar.
3) Nikon 4-16x42mm M-223 BDC 600: The AR-15 wasn’t designed as a long range rifle, but may free-floated and fast-twist barrels are capable of reaching long range, making the AR-15 far more useful with long range shots. The Nikon scope maximizes accuracy at those distances, offering a generous magnification range and side-focus parallax adjustment. Again, it will cost a bit more, but the longer range and quality are worth the price.
4) Leupold Mark 8 1.1-8x24mm CQBSS: This scope is at the top end of prices. However, it is the best of the best. When price isn’t a problem, this is the ideal scope. It allows the operator the ability to reach 8x for long-range shots and can give the user enough field of view to clear a building. It is pricey, but it offers the best of the best in AR-15 scopes.
5) Simmons Predator Quest 4.5-18x44mm: This scope has a vast magnification range, and a generous objective lens. With a 30mm main tube, it can transmit a good amount of light, and it can be adjusted for windage and elevation, and side-focus for parallax. This scope offers all the tools to make precision shots, without costing a large amount.
